AIR IN THE BELLY: THE FOODS THAT CAUSE IT

  1. Foods with Fodmaps.

    In essence, fodmaps are small or large sugar chains. such as for example lactose or polyols. We find them in dairy products, wheat, fruit and vegetables and almost all legumes.

  2. Fermentable fibers.

    The fibers can be divided according to different classifications. Viscous or non-viscous, insoluble or soluble, fermentable or non-fermentable. Fermentable fibers are for example resistant starch (some types, for example glucomannan), chitosan, gums, pectins (apple peel, citrus fruit), hemicellulose (fruit, vegetables), beta-glucans (barley, legumes), fructans.

  3. Probiotics and prebiotics.

    Some fibers with a prebiotic function fall into case two. Probiotics that produce lactic acid in the gut are not well tolerated by everyone, and can create air in the belly, constipation, and other ailments. This means that not everyone reacts well to yogurt, for example, because lactobacilli are part of this type of probiotic.

  4. Cow’s milk and dairy products.

    Belly air could either be associated with lactose or a particular category of casein that is abundant in cow’s milk and dairy products, but is nearly neutralized in aged cheeses. There are many perplexities on this point, it must be said, but in case of adverse symptoms it is better to focus on goat or sheep milk and goat, sheep and buffalo dairy products (which would be an exception).

  5. Foods with antinutrients.

    Antinutrients found mainly in plant-based products are also being studied for their positive properties. However, they can create food shortages and cause belly air, colic, constipation and spasms. There are many and not all of them are destroyed in cooking or soaking. I list them here.

As you can see, there are a lot of foods that cause air in the belly.
So much so that it is difficult for a person to try to figure out how to eat to avoid this problem.
As a general advice , if you suffer from air in the belly I would ask you to pay attention to the peel and seeds of fruit and vegetables, to legumes, to wholemeal products, to additives such as guar gum or xanthana or carrageenan in industrial products, to products fermented (sauerkraut, fermented cheeses, etc.) and fresh cow’s milk and dairy products, salads.
